2 definitions found From The Collaborative International Dictionary of English v.0.48 [gcide]: Counterman \Coun"ter*man\ (koun"t[~e]r*man), n.; pl. {Countermen} (-men). A man who attends at the counter of a shop to sell goods. [Eng.] [1913 Webster] From WordNet (r) 2.0 [wn]: counterman n : someone who attends a counter (as in a diner) [syn: {counterperson}, {counterwoman}]
